Brief specs of 2004 TVR Tuscan

2-door 2-seater coupé, petrol (gasoline) 6-cylinder 24-valve straight (inline) engine, DOHC (double overhead camshafts, twin cam), 3605 cm3 / 220.0 cu in / 220.0 cu in, 261.0 kW / 350.0 hp / 350.0 hp @ 7200 rpm / 7200 rpm / 7200 rpm, 402.0 N·m / 296.5 lb·ft / 296.5 lb·ft @ 5500 rpm / 5500 rpm / 5500 rpm, rear wheel drive, 280 km/h / 174 mph / 174 mph top speed, consumption 13.0 l/100km / 21.7 mpg-UK / 18.1 mpg-US
